Abstract
The discovery of a series of 6-(4-pyridyl)pyrimidin-4(3H)-ones derived from a hit compound with low molecular weight and sufficient chemical space is reported. Transformation of substituents led to subnanomolar potent inhibitors with in vivo tau phoshorylation lowering activity.
